Maintaining fitness can feel like a challenge when you’re constantly juggling work, family, and social commitments.

However, effective home workouts can help you stay fit, even with a packed schedule.

The key is finding exercises that maximize results in minimal time, so let’s dive into some strategies that will help you stay active without overwhelming your day.

1. Bodyweight Exercises: No Equipment, No Problem

Bodyweight exercises are fantastic because they require zero equipment and can be done anywhere.

These exercises not only save you time but also provide a full-body workout that helps build strength, endurance, and flexibility.

  • Push-ups: A classic that works the chest, shoulders, and core.

    You can modify them based on your strength level.

  • Squats: Engage your legs and glutes, and improve your balance.

  • Planks: Strengthen your core without needing to move around too much—perfect for when you’re short on time.

  • Lunges: A simple lower body exercise that targets your legs, hips, and glutes.

  • Burpees: If you’re looking to elevate your heart rate quickly, this full-body move combines strength and cardio.

2. High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T): Maximum Burn in Minimum Time

When your schedule is tight, High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T) is a lifesaver.

This workout style combines short bursts of intense exercise with periods of rest or low-intensity movements.

HIIT is effective for burning fat and building muscle in a short amount of time—often in 20 minutes or less.

A basic HIIT circuit could include:

  • 30 seconds of jumping jacks

  • 30 seconds of mountain climbers

  • 30 seconds of squats

  • 30 seconds of burpees
    Repeat this circuit 3–4 times with 20-second rest periods in between.

Why it works: You get a cardiovascular and strength-training workout simultaneously, making it ideal for busy days when you can only carve out small pockets of time.

3. Tabata Training: The 4-Minute Miracle

If you thought HIIT was fast, Tabata training takes it up a notch.

Originating from Japan, Tabata involves performing 20 seconds of ultra-high-intensity exercise followed by 10 seconds of rest, repeated for 4 minutes.

It’s a great option for those truly pressed for time but still wanting a serious workout.

A sample Tabata session could include:

  • Push-ups

  • Jump squats

  • High knees

  • Bicycle crunches

This workout only takes four minutes but provides significant cardiovascular and muscular benefits.

4. Yoga and Stretching: Flexibility and Calm in a Crunch

Even when you’re short on time, it’s important to remember flexibility and recovery.

Practicing yoga or simple stretching routines for just 10-15 minutes can improve mobility, reduce stress, and keep your muscles limber.

  • Sun Salutations: A quick sequence that stretches the whole body and improves circulation.

  • Downward Dog to Cobra Flow: Works both flexibility and core strength.

  • Hip openers and shoulder stretches: Perfect if you’re seated at a desk all day.

Bonus: Yoga doubles as a mental break, offering the chance to relax and reset your mind amidst a busy day.

5. Mini Workouts: Sneak in Fitness Throughout the Day

Sometimes, a continuous 30-minute workout isn’t feasible.

In this case, breaking your exercise into mini-workouts throughout the day can still be effective.

Research shows that these “exercise snacks” can boost metabolism and improve fitness.

For example:

  • Morning: Do 10 minutes of bodyweight exercises (push-ups, squats, lunges).

  • Lunch break: Take a brisk 10-15 minute walk.

  • Evening: A quick 10-minute core workout (planks, crunches, leg raises).

These micro sessions add up and keep your energy levels high without feeling like you’re dedicating a massive chunk of time to fitness.

6. Workout Apps and Online Programs: Structure and Guidance

If you prefer structured workouts but lack the time to attend a gym class, there are plenty of fitness apps and online programs that offer quick, effective workouts.

You can tailor these to your schedule and fitness level, and many apps provide built-in timers, so you don’t have to worry about tracking time.

Popular apps include:

  • Nike Training Club: Offers free workouts that range from 5 minutes to 45 minutes, including strength, cardio, and yoga options.

  • Seven: All workouts are 7 minutes long, making it easy to squeeze fitness into your day.

  • FitOn: Provides free HIIT, strength, and pilates workouts led by expert trainers.

7. Resistance Bands: Portable Strength Training

Investing in a simple set of resistance bands can give your home workouts an extra edge.

They’re small, inexpensive, and can target multiple muscle groups.

Whether you’re doing bicep curls, glute bridges, or chest presses, resistance bands add an extra challenge to your bodyweight exercises without taking up space in your home.

8. Jump Rope: Cardio on the Go

A jump rope is one of the best tools for a quick cardio session.

It takes up minimal space and gives you a high-intensity workout in as little as 10 minutes.

Just a few rounds of jumping can improve coordination, stamina, and heart health.

Plus, it’s fun!

Consistency is Key: Make it a Routine

No matter which workout method you choose, consistency is what drives results.

Create a routine that you can stick to.

If you only have 15 minutes a day, commit to that.

The beauty of home workouts is the flexibility they offer—you can work out on your schedule without the pressure of gym hours or commutes.
